Understanding Varicose Veins

Varicose veins happen when veins become bigger or inflamed due to malfunctioning valves. Frequently looking like blue or dark purple bulges on the legs, they can lead to pain or more extreme complications if left without treatment. Types of Varicose Vein Removal Procedures

Sclerotherapy: A Non-Surgical Approach

Sclerotherapy includes injecting a service into the affected veins, triggering them to collapse and fade gradually. It's typically recommended for smaller varicose veins and spider veins.

Laser Treatments: Advanced Technology

Laser therapy uses focused light energy to target specific areas of the vein without harming surrounding tissue. This method is less intrusive and often requires minimal downtime.

Endovenous Laser Treatment (EVLT)

EVLT is a minimally intrusive treatment where laser energy is used inside the vein. It's significantly popular due to its efficiency and quick healing time compared to traditional surgical methods.

Preparing for Your Procedure

Pre-Procedure Guidelines

In preparation for your varicose vein elimination:

    Avoid blood thinners like aspirin. Stay hydrated. Discuss any medications with your physician ahead of time.

These steps will help make sure that the procedure runs smoothly and safely.

During the Procedure: What Happens?

Anesthesia Alternatives Explained

Depending on the kind of treatment picked:

    Local anesthesia might be utilized for sclerotherapy. Sedation might be provided for more substantial procedures like EVLT.

Your vein doctor will go over these options during your consultation.

Step-by-Step Introduction of Common Procedures

Preparation: The area will be cleaned up and marked. Anesthesia: Administered based upon private needs. Procedure Execution: The selected technique (sclerotherapy/laser) will take place. Monitoring: Post-procedure tracking guarantees no instant issues arise.

Long-term Care: Maintaining Healthy Veins

Lifestyle Modifications Towards Healthy Veins

Adopting much healthier habits can substantially impact your vein health:

Regular workout enhances circulation. Maintaining a healthy weight decreases pressure on leg veins. Wearing compression stockings can provide support throughout extended sitting or standing periods.

FAQs About Varicose Vein Removal

1. What triggers varicose veins?

Varicose veins are primarily caused by weakened valves in the veins, causing bad blood flow back towards the heart.

3. Are there dangers associated with varicose vein removal?

As with any medical treatment, dangers include bleeding, infection, or allergies however are normally low when performed by experienced experts at reliable clinics.

4. For how long does healing take after varicose vein removal?

Recovery times differ depending upon the type of treatment but most clients go back to normal activities within a week while sticking closely to aftercare guidelines supplied by their doctors.

5. Are there non-surgical alternatives available?

Yes! Sclerotherapy and laser treatments work non-surgical choices available at numerous vein treatment centers concentrating on innovative techniques for dealing with varicosities without significant cut procedures.
